After an admittedly gradual begin to the season, Brussels is again in full swing, and so are we with this article.

Anticipate a wild transition interval as European Fee President Ursula von der Leyen assembles her new workforce and the bloc’s future EU diplomat, Kaja Kallas, takes over from incumbent Josep Borrell.

And there might be extra wrestling over the EU’s continued response to Ukraine, tit-for-tat tariffs with China, and a nail-biting US election pitting Kamala Harris towards Donald Trump.

Right here’s a run-down of the important thing occasions to maintain an eye fixed out for:

BATTLES AHEAD | With a flurry of self-declared peace missions on Ukraine earlier than summer season, Hunagry’s Prime Minister Viktor Orbán branded himself as a intermediary who may repair sure points with Russia, China, or different actors thinking about influencing European politics.

The transfer, nonetheless, has irritated the EU and its member states, culminating within the choice to downgrade and transfer Thursday’s prestigious assembly from Budapest to Brussels. And there’s extra to come back.

ESCALATION RISK | Because the struggle between Israel and Gaza approaches the one-year mark, Jean-Pierre Lacroix, the UN Below-Secretary-Common for Peace Operations, referred to as on Europeans to not underestimate the danger of an escalation within the area.

RESTRICTIONS UPDATE | Ukraine this week stepped up its push for Western approval to strike army targets deep inside Russia, urging allies to raise restrictions on using their donated long-range weapons.

EUMAM TARGET | The EU is anticipated to boost its coaching targets for Ukraine’s military from the present 60,000 to 75,000 by the top of the yr as ministers look into reviewing the mission’s mandate, however the concept of transferring coaching in Ukraine remains to be removed from getting unanimous help.
